A copy of ApplicationController

Hola, me ha salido este error al añadir un map.resources en routes

A copy of ApplicationController has been removed from the module tree
but is still active!

Tengo mi controlador Categories para el admin y para el frontend, al añadir
esta línea ha sido cuando ha salido el error:
map.resources :categories, :path_prefix => ‘/systems’

Y para el admin tengo:
map.with_options :path_prefix => ‘/admin’ do |admin|
admin.resources :categories,
:name_prefix=>‘admin_’,:path_prefix=>“admin/:type”
,:controller=>“admin/categories”
end

Lo raro es que tengo otros controladores creados así y no me ha dado
problemas, salvo en éste, hay alguna
explicación?

Preguntas:

  1. Versión de Rails?
  2. Environment (dev o prod?)
  3. Para qué usas with_options (en el segundo caso) si terminas
    reescribiendolo? *map.with_options :path_prefix *
    admin.resources :categories, :name_prefix=>‘admin_’,…
  4. Si agregas otras rutas, luego de haber agregado esa, te pasa lo
    mismo?
    O es sólo con esa?

Puede llegar a ser un tema de cache de clases, por eso la pregunta 2.

Saludos
Lucas

On Thu, Jun 5, 2008 at 6:10 AM, Miguel Angel Calleja Lázaro <

Lucas F. escribió:

Puede llegar a ser un tema de cache de clases, por eso la pregunta 2.

Saludos
Lucas

Hola Lucas

  1. 2.0
  2. Development
  3. Cierto
  4. En otras rutas he hecho lo mismo y ha funcionado, sólo me ha pasado
    con ésa

Al final he optado por buscar otro nombre al controlador y he tirado pa
lante. Puede que tengas razón, algo hize raro al crear ese controlador,
lo borré, lo volví a crear, bueno, gracias.